The durability of a window begins before the system is even placed in the wall. The rough opening needs to be appropriately prepared to avoid structural rot and energy loss.
1. Accurate Measurement
Installers need to determine the rough opening in three places: the leading, middle, and bottom for width, and the left, center, and right for height. The smallest measurement is utilized to order the window, normally deducting 1/2 inch from the width and height to permit for expansion and leveling.
2. Looking for Level and Square
The sill (the bottom horizontal part of the opening) must be level. If it is not, shims must be placed before the window is set up. The opening should likewise be looked for "square" by measuring the diagonals; if the diagonal measurements are equivalent, the opening is square.
3. Waterproofing (Flashing)
Applying flashing tape to the sill and up the sides (the jambs) is an important action. This ensures that any water that handles to get behind the outside siding is directed far from the wood framing of the home.
Step-by-Step Installation Process
Once the opening is prepared, the real installation of the sliding window system can start.
Step 1: Dry Fitting the Window
Before applying any sealant, the window should be positioned into the opening to ensure an appropriate fit. The installer ought to confirm that there is sufficient room for shimming which the window sits flush against the exterior stops or sheathing.
Step 2: Applying the Sealant Bead
After removing the Traditional Window Installers from the dry fit, a continuous bead of high-quality sealant is applied to the interior side of the outside case or the nailing fin. This creates the primary barrier against air and water.
Step 3: Setting the Window
The window is tilted into the opening, bottom first, and then pushed into the sealant. It is vital at this stage to have a second person inside to ensure the window does not fall through the opening.
Step 4: Shimming and Leveling
Shims are placed in between the window frame and the rough opening. They ought to be placed near the screw holes. The goal is to make sure the frame is completely level (horizontally), plumb (vertically), and square.

Tip: For sliding windows, it is specifically important that the bottom track is level. If the track is bowed or slanted, the rollers will not slide correctly, and the locking system may not line up.
Step 5: Securing the Frame
Once the window is leveled and plumb, screws are driven through the frame (or the nailing fin) into the wall studs. Screws should not be over-tightened, as this can bow the frame and trigger the sashes to bind.
Step 6: Insulating the Gaps
The space in between the window frame and the rough opening need to be filled with low-expansion spray foam. Standard high-expansion foam need to be avoided, as the pressure can warp the window frame.

To make sure the sliding window continues to run smoothly after setup, a simple maintenance regimen is advised:
Track Cleaning: Vacuum the tracks frequently to remove dust, pests, and debris that can grind down the rollers.Lubrication: Use a dry silicone spray on the tracks as soon as a year. Can a sliding window be installed by a single individual?
While smaller units might be workable, it is highly suggested to have two individuals. A single person handles the exterior positioning while the other guarantees the window is plumb and safe and secure from the interior.
2. The length of time does the installation procedure usually take?
For a professional, changing a single sliding window normally takes 2 to 4 hours, depending upon the condition of the existing frame and the kind of exterior siding.
3. Is it much better to set up a sliding window with or without a nailing fin?
Nailing fins (or flanges) are ideal for brand-new building or when the outside siding is being replaced. For "insert" replacements where the initial frame remains in place, a block-frame window (without fins) is usually utilized.
4. Why is my new sliding window difficult to move?
This is frequently brought on by the frame being "out of square" or the center of the sill being bowed upward due to over-shimming. If the rollers are adjusted too low, the sash might also be dragging out the track.
5. Are sliding windows energy effective?
Yes, modern sliding windows with double or triple glazing and Low-E finishings are really efficient. However, due to the fact that they depend on brush-style weatherstripping to permit motion, they might have somewhat higher air infiltration rates than repaired or casement windows.
